Data plays a critical role in the success of maintenance management systems. This is especially true with enterprise-level solutions like SAP, where a single source of data is utilized by multiple groups within an organization. Furthermore, as technology advances and maintenance originations are able to take advantage of tools like mobile devices and advanced analytics, the importance of data will become even more critical. Many companies struggle with how to how to determine the quality of their data, as well as what indicators to measure. This presentation will focus on the value of good data, and discuss tools that have been developed to help analyze that quality of EAM data across your organization.

JAMESTOWN, KY. - Construction crews at the Wolf Creek Dam Foundation Remediation Project reached a lofty safety milestone today when the men and women installing a concrete barrier wall deep into the dam’s embankment reached 550 days and one million work-hours on the job without a lost-time accident.
ABERDEEN, UK /PRNewswire via COMTEX/—Wood Group GTS has been awarded a multi-year rotating equipment managed maintenance services contract for the Brent Assets of Shell UK. This award provides comprehensive support services for power generation packages and follows the establishment of an enterprise framework agreement (EFA) last year between Wood Group GTS and Shell.
